Medusa decor
Medusa decor is a captivating theme that blends ancient mythology with modern aesthetics, making it an excellent choice for those looking to make a powerful design statement. Originating from Greek mythology, Medusa is often depicted with snakes as hair and a gaze that petrifies, symbolizing protection and transformation. This unique symbolism can be transformed into home decor pieces such as wall art, sculptures, and intricate masks that serve both decorative and meaningful purposes. When incorporating Medusa decor into your space, consider using a mix of materials and styles to suit your personal taste. For a classic look, marble or stone Medusa busts add a touch of elegance and authenticity. Alternatively, metallic finishes like gold or bronze can create a luxurious vibe and highlight the intricate details of Medusa's features. For a contemporary approach, black-and-white prints or abstract representations can blend seamlessly with minimalist interiors. Lighting plays a crucial role in showcasing Medusa decor effectively. Strategically placed spotlights or ambient lighting can emphasize the textures and details of sculptures or framed artworks, transforming them into captivating focal points. Additionally, pairing Medusa decor with elements such as leafy plants or dark-colored furnishings can enhance the mythological and mysterious atmosphere. Beyond aesthetics, Medusa decor can also be symbolic in personal spaces. Many consider it a protective emblem, warding off negative energy or evil spirits. Including Medusa motifs in entryways or living rooms integrates this belief into your home’s energy. For those interested in DIY projects, creating Medusa-inspired art can be rewarding. Using clay, paper mache, or even 3D printing, you can craft custom Medusa designs that reflect your style. Online tutorials and templates make these projects accessible even for beginners.
